System and method for structuring an online auction when reserve price is not met
First Claim
1. A computer-implemented method for providing a dynamically-updated bidder interface for an online auction, the method being implemented by a network system and comprising:
- providing, on a computing device of a bidder of the online auction, a bidder interface that enables bidding on an item being auctioned when the online auction is in progress, wherein the bidder interface allows entry of a bid based on a bid increment having a default value;
determining to alter the bid increment of the online auction based at least in part on;
(i) a reserve price for the online auction not being met, and (ii) a time remaining for the online auction;
in response to determining to alter the bid increment, automatically updating the bidder interface to include an indication that the bid has not met the reserve price and an updated bid increment based on a difference between a current highest bid for the online auction and the reserve price of the online auction;
in response to determining to alter the bid increment, extending an ending time for the online auction; and
in response to extending the online auction, enabling, via the bidder interface, the bidder to send a message to a seller of the item of the online auction.

Abstract
A system and method for structuring an online auction when a reserve price is not met are described. In an online auction, bidding activity is analyzed over a duration to determine whether there are multiple active bidders for the auction and whether the reserve price for the auction is met after a designated period of time. In response to making that determination, the bidder interface for a sole active bidder on the auction can be automatically updated to include a notification that the bid has not met the reserve price and an option to place a new bid on the item so that the auction is successful and does not end with no bids meeting the reserve.
